copyright's Energy Conundrum: The Environmental Impact of Mining

While Bitcoin have revolutionized finance and technology, their energy consumption has become a major concern. Mining, the process of verifying and adding transactions to the blockchain, requires massive amounts of electricity. Critics argue that this high requirement contributes significantly to global greenhouse gas outflows, raising questions about its sustainability.

  • Advocates of Bitcoin argue that its energy expenditure is offset by the benefits it brings to society, such as increased financial inclusion.
  • Others point to the potential for renewable energy sources in mining operations, which could reduce its environmental influence.
  • Implementing sustainable solutions to Bitcoin's energy conundrum is crucial for its long-term success.

Boosting Your Bitcoin Mining Hash Rate: A Comprehensive Guide

Mining Bitcoin requires a substantial understanding of hardware and software optimization. One crucial factor is maximizing your hash rate – the amount of computational power your mining rig contributes. Achieving a high hash rate can significantly increase your earnings, as it directly influences how quickly you can solve complex cryptographic puzzles and earn rewards.

To effectively optimize your Bitcoin mining rig for maximum hash rate, consider these key factors:

  • Select the most efficient mining hardware available on the market. ASIC miners are specifically designed for Bitcoin mining and offer unparalleled performance compared to general-purpose GPUs.
  • Ensure your cooling system is robust enough to prevent overheating, which can drastically reduce hash rate performance.
  • Fine-tune your mining software settings to maximize efficiency. Experiment with different algorithms and options to identify the optimal configuration for your hardware.
  • Maintain a stable and reliable internet connection for uninterrupted mining operations. Network latency can negatively impact your hash rate, so prioritize a high-speed connection with minimal interruptions.
